1562f964aa7SSimon Glassconfig DEBUG_UART
1572f964aa7SSimon Glass	bool "Enable an early debug UART for debugging"
1582f964aa7SSimon Glass	help
1592f964aa7SSimon Glass	  The debug UART is intended for use very early in U-Boot to debug
1602f964aa7SSimon Glass	  problems when an ICE or other debug mechanism is not available.
1612f964aa7SSimon Glass
1622f964aa7SSimon Glass	  To use it you should:
1632f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Make sure your UART supports this interface
1642f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Enable CONFIG_DEBUG_UART
1652f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Enable the CONFIG for your UART to tell it to provide this interface
1662f964aa7SSimon Glass	        (e.g. CONFIG_DEBUG_UART_NS16550)
1672f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Define the required settings as needed (see below)
1682f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Call debug_uart_init() before use
1692f964aa7SSimon Glass	  - Call debug_uart_putc() to output a character
1702f964aa7SSimon Glass
1712f964aa7SSimon Glass	  Depending on your platform it may be possible to use this UART before
1722f964aa7SSimon Glass	  a stack is available.
1732f964aa7SSimon Glass
1742f964aa7SSimon Glass	  If your UART does not support this interface you can probably add
1752f964aa7SSimon Glass	  support quite easily. Remember that you cannot use driver model and
1762f964aa7SSimon Glass	  it is preferred to use no stack.
1772f964aa7SSimon Glass
1782f964aa7SSimon Glass	  You must not use this UART once driver model is working and the
1792f964aa7SSimon Glass	  serial drivers are up and running (done in serial_init()). Otherwise
1802f964aa7SSimon Glass	  the drivers may conflict and you will get strange output.

412dd0b0122SSimon Glassconfig DEBUG_UART_SHIFT
413dd0b0122SSimon Glass	int "UART register shift"
414dd0b0122SSimon Glass	depends on DEBUG_UART
415dd0b0122SSimon Glass	default 0 if DEBUG_UART
416dd0b0122SSimon Glass	help
417dd0b0122SSimon Glass	  Some UARTs (notably ns16550) support different register layouts
418dd0b0122SSimon Glass	  where the registers are spaced either as bytes, words or some other
419dd0b0122SSimon Glass	  value. Use this value to specify the shift to use, where 0=byte
420dd0b0122SSimon Glass	  registers, 2=32-bit word registers, etc.
421dd0b0122SSimon Glass
4220e977bc1SSimon Glassconfig DEBUG_UART_BOARD_INIT
4230e977bc1SSimon Glass	bool "Enable board-specific debug UART init"
4240e977bc1SSimon Glass	depends on DEBUG_UART
4250e977bc1SSimon Glass	help
4260e977bc1SSimon Glass	  Some boards need to set things up before the debug UART can be used.
4270e977bc1SSimon Glass	  On these boards a call to debug_uart_init() is insufficient. When
4280e977bc1SSimon Glass	  this option is enabled, the function board_debug_uart_init() will
4290e977bc1SSimon Glass	  be called when debug_uart_init() is called. You can put any code
4300e977bc1SSimon Glass	  here that is needed to set up the UART ready for use, such as set
4310e977bc1SSimon Glass	  pin multiplexing or enable clocks.

620af282245SSimon Glassconfig SANDBOX_SERIAL
621af282245SSimon Glass	bool "Sandbox UART support"
6222ea65f3eSMasahiro Yamada	depends on SANDBOX
623af282245SSimon Glass	help
624af282245SSimon Glass	  Select this to enable a seral UART for sandbox. This is required to
625af282245SSimon Glass	  operate correctly, otherwise you will see no serial output from
626af282245SSimon Glass	  sandbox. The emulated UART will display to the console and console
627af282245SSimon Glass	  input will be fed into the UART. This allows you to interact with
628af282245SSimon Glass	  U-Boot.
629af282245SSimon Glass
630af282245SSimon Glass	  The operation of the console is controlled by the -t command-line
631af282245SSimon Glass	  flag. In raw mode, U-Boot sees all characters from the terminal
632af282245SSimon Glass	  before they are processed, including Ctrl-C. In cooked mode, Ctrl-C
633af282245SSimon Glass	  is processed by the terminal, and terminates U-Boot. Valid options
634af282245SSimon Glass	  are:
635af282245SSimon Glass
636af282245SSimon Glass	     -t raw-with-sigs	Raw mode, Ctrl-C will terminate U-Boot
637af282245SSimon Glass	     -t raw		Raw mode, Ctrl-C is processed by U-Boot
638af282245SSimon Glass	     -t cooked		Cooked mode, Ctrl-C terminates
